The Journey from Naples Airport to the Amalfi Coast
The experience begins right at the Naples International Airport, where your driver — typically Giuseppe, based on reviews — will be waiting at the designated blue dot. The simplicity of this meeting point makes arrivals less stressful, especially after a tiring flight. You’ll hop into a clean, comfortable vehicle, often described as new and well-maintained, which makes a big difference after a long journey.
The drive takes around 1 to 2 hours, depending on traffic and stops. One of the key advantages of choosing a private transfer over a bus or shared shuttle is the flexibility to tailor your journey. If you’re eager to stretch your legs and take in the views, your driver can pause at a scenic spot, providing opportunities for photos and soaking in the stunning vistas of the coast.
The scenic stops are a highlight — reviews often mention how drivers like Giuseppe are happy to stop briefly for panoramic photos, which are priceless for capturing memories. It’s a chance to breathe in the fresh coastal air and admire the cliffside villages, lush greenery, and sparkling sea that make the Amalfi Coast so famous.

FAQs
Is this transfer private or shared?
It’s a private transfer, meaning only your group will participate, offering privacy and personalized service.
What’s included in the price?
The fare covers the door-to-door service, WiFi, bottled water, and the flexibility to stop for scenic views.
How long does the transfer take?
The journey typically lasts around 1 to 2 hours, depending on traffic and stops.
What happens if my flight is delayed?
If your flight is delayed beyond the first hour after your scheduled pickup, there’s a small surcharge. It’s best to inform the provider of delays.
Can I stop for sightseeing along the way?
Yes, stops for panoramic views or photos are encouraged and accommodated by your driver.
Is the vehicle comfortable?
Yes, reviews mention the cars are new, clean, and well-maintained, making the ride pleasant.
Is WiFi available during the transfer?
Absolutely, WiFi is offered, helping you connect or plan once in transit.
Are service animals allowed?
Yes, service animals are permitted.
How do I find my driver at the airport?
Your driver will be waiting at the blue dot inside Naples Airport, a clear and easy-to-find meeting point.
